$(this).ajaxSubmit({ url : "login", //设置提交的 url,可覆盖 action 属性 target : "#box", //服务器返回的内容存放在#box里 type : "GET", dateType : null, //xml,json,script,默认为 null //clearForm : true, //成功提交后,清空表单 //resetForm : true, //成功提交后,重置表单 data...
#1、ajaxForm 提交 $('#form-js-demo').ajaxForm(function(obj) { console.log(obj);//obj 后台处理数据的返回值}); #2、ajaxSubmit 提交 $('#form-js-demo').submit(function() { $('#form-js-demo').ajaxSubmit(function(obj) {//obj 后台处理数据的返回值console.log(obj); });returnfalse;...
$(function () { $("#ajaxForm").ajaxForm(function () { alert("提交成功1"); }); $("#ajaxForm").submit(function () { $(this).ajaxSubmit(function () { alert("提交成功1"); }); return false; }); $("#btnButton").click(function () { $("#ajaxF...
1.Ajax提交是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术。 2.也就是所谓的异步。异步指不用进程一直等待当前执行完毕,可以直接执行后面的的进程,当有消息返回时系统会通知进程进行处理,这样可以提高效率。 3.Ajax异步提交方法也是通过XMLHttpRequset来进行数据交互和提交的。 通过固定写法判断并实例...
jquery form插件ajax上传文件的原理, 1、浏览器实现了XMLHttpRequest level2规范的,则插件使用xhr直接提交文件。通常来说chrome、firefox都实现了xhr level2规范 2、浏览器只实现了XMLHttpRequest level1规范的,则插件使用form+iframe方式,实现页面无刷新上传文件。通常来说,IE8及以下都属于此列。
此方法需要引入jquery.form.js 文件 前言 使用Form表单提交数据,并产生异步回调。 遇到一个ajaxForm不回调问题 --已解决 ajaxForm: 两个主...
3.表单提交插件jquery.form.js 官网:https://github.com/malsup/form 封装jquery的post,get,ajax等方法,简化表单提交。eg: JavaScript 复制代码 9 1 2 3 4 5 6 7 // bind submit handler to form $('form').on('submit',function(e){ e.preventDefault();// prevent native submit $(this)....
这个框架集合form提交、验证、上传的功能。 这个框架必须和jquery完整版结合,否则使用min则无效。 原理:利用js进行对form进行组装成ajax的url和data,原理还是用ajax来提交,其实这完全可以自己写,但是有这个框架可能会更简单。 一、最简单例子: 第一步:引用js ...
ajaxForm: 先下载:http://files.cnblogs.com/china-li/jquery.form.js 两个主要的API:ajaxForm() ajaxSubmit()。 ajaxForm()配置完之后,并不是马上的提交,而是要等submit()事件,它只是一个准备。一般用法: $(document).ready(function() {varoptions ={ ...
到了2012年1月31日,jQuery 5正式版问世,这一版本包含众多重大改进,如Ajax模块的重写、新增的延缓对象(Deferred Objects)功能、以及jQuery.sub()替身等。同时,该版本还进一步优化了遍历相邻节点的性能,并对开发团队的构建系统进行了改进。随后在2013年4月18日,jQuery 0正式版得以发布。此版本不再支持IE6/7/8...